Latest Patents
Sara's patent, titled "Surface treatment formulation for inhibiting scaling or climbing of a surface," introduces a unique solution. This formulation features a base binding material designed to adhere securely to various surfaces, along with a filler material embedded within it. The inclusion of a dry lubricant, characterized by a layered lamellar structure or low inter-filler interaction, facilitates the creation of a slippery surface when activated. This innovative approach effectively inhibits the scaling or climbing of surfaces, marking a significant advancement in surface treatment technologies.
